ul.pagination{
	margin:9px !important;
	padding:0px !important;
	height:100% !important;
	overflow:hidden !important;
	font:12px 'Tahoma' !important;
	list-style-type:none !important;
	float:left !important;
	width:100% !important;
}

ul.pagination li.details{
        padding: 5px 10px !important;
    font-size: 14px !important;
    /* width: 16% !important; */
    /* padding: 2px 7px !important; */
    /* border: 1px solid #fff !important; */
    /* margin-top: 10px; */
}

ul.pagination li.dot{padding: 3px 0 10px 0px !important;}

ul.pagination li{
	float: left !important;
    /* margin: 0px !important; */
    /* margin-left: 5px !important; */
    /* width: auto !important; */
    background: RGBA(0,0,0,.82) !important;
    color: #fff !important;
}

ul.pagination li:first-child{
	    /* margin-left: 0px !important; */
    /* width: 16% !important; */

}

ul.pagination li a{
	    color: #fff !important;
    display: block !important;
    text-decoration: none !important;
    /* padding: 7px 5px 7px 5px !important; */
    /* border: 1px solid #fff !important; */
}

ul.pagination li a:hover{
	color:#fff !important;
	display:block !important;
	text-decoration:none !important;
	
}

ul.pagination li a img{
	border:none !important;
}
	
	ul.pagination li .current
	{
		color:red;
	}